Output eda96fcce8366acba18aa80984f7d2097b65326c68e2317b2dcfc192d1d85cba:0

value
32312010
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 33d884343504826fba6fd7bf2c9e56589b4786b448f6b1d13e5a614d91e359ef
address
tb1px0vggdp4qjpxlwn067lje8jktzd50p45frmtr5f7tfs5my0rt8hshm2egp
transaction
eda96fcce8366acba18aa80984f7d2097b65326c68e2317b2dcfc192d1d85cba
confirmations
24096
spent
true